Teaching English as a Foreign Language (TEFL) is a rewarding career choice that opens up opportunities to work globally. The Level 5 Certificate in TEFL with Practice is a comprehensive course that equips individuals with the skills and knowledge needed to excel in this field.
The Level 5 Certificate in TEFL with Practice goes beyond the basics of TEFL and provides practical experience through teaching practice sessions. This hands-on approach allows participants to apply their learning in real classroom settings, gaining valuable insights and feedback.
| Statistic | Value |
|---|---|
| Total Course Duration | 120 hours |
| Practical Teaching Hours | 20 hours |
| Assessment Method | Assignments and Teaching Practice |
| Qualification Level | Level 5 (Equivalent to Foundation Degree) |
